Dental Assistant Hourly Pay in Skokie, IL: $22.67 (2026)
Quick Answer:Hourly pay for a dental assistant working in Skokie, IL runs $22.67 at the median for 2026 — annualizing to $47,143 at a standard 2,080-hour year. Figures projected from BLS OEWS 2025 (SOC 31-9091). Weighted against Skokie's regional price level (BEA RPP 97.1, 3% below national), each hour of work buys what $23.35 nationally would. A 24-hour part-time schedule grosses $28,292 per year.

Dental Assistant Hourly Wage Breakdown
| Percentile | Hourly Rate | Per 8hr Shift |
|---|---|---|
| Entry Level (P10) | $18.02 | $144.15 |
| Lower Range (P25) | $20.64 | $165.11 |
| Median (P50) | $22.67 | $181.36 |
| Upper Range (P75) | $27.52 | $220.14 |
| Top Earners (P90) | $29.31 | $234.50 |

Hourly Rate Trajectory for Dental Assistants in Skokie (2019–2027)
2019–2025: actual BLS OEWS data for this metro area. 2026+: CAGR 3.14% projection.
| Year | Hourly Rate | Status |
|---|---|---|
| 2019 | $18.33/hr | Actual |
| 2020 | $18.83/hr | Actual |
| 2021 | $17.68/hr | Actual |
| 2022 | $20.49/hr | Actual |
| 2023 | $21.28/hr | Actual |
| 2024 | $20.99/hr | Actual |
| 2025 | $21.98/hr | Actual |
| 2026(current) | $22.67/hr | Estimated |
| 2027 | $23.38/hr | Projected |
Based on 7 years of BLS OEWS metropolitan area data, the median hourly rate for dental assistants in Skokie grew 19.9% from $18.33/hr (2019) to $21.98/hr (2025). At a 3.14% projected growth rate, hourly pay is expected to reach $23.38/hr by 2027. Part-time and per-diem dental assistants can use this multi-year trend to benchmark future contract negotiations.

Working as an Hourly Dental Assistant in Skokie
Amidst the shifting tide of dental practices, many Skokie dental assistants find themselves weighing choices that affect their take-home pay significantly. A part-time dental assistant working 24 hours per week could realistically bring home about $28,070 annually, compared to a full-time assistant who might see a larger yearly income, thus emphasizing the financial implications of employment type. Per diem and agency work is another avenue for many dental assistants, who frequently charge between $22 and $35 per hour, with specialized roles in oral surgery and orthodontics often demanding pay rates that can climb higher, from $28 to $45 per hour. Furthermore, hourly wages can fluctuate depending on the type of employer; general practices often pay differently from specialty offices or larger dental service organizations like Heartland and Aspen, where the pay scales are typically standardized. While some dental assistants may accept lower hourly rates for the security of benefits like health insurance, others opt for higher-paying positions that offer more flexible schedules. For those looking to negotiate their pay, emphasizing relevant certifications or expanded function skills can prove advantageous in the competitive job market of Skokie, IL.
